🏆 Last Wednesday, during our Basketball Night, we gathered to celebrate our January Athletes of the Month! Congratulations to Colleen Breslin of Youth Recreation, Ben Edmonds, Campbell Shelby, and Princes Akojenu of Episcopal High School, Amirah Anderson and Ripp Kodi of Bishop Ireton High School, Riley Jacobs and Naheema Goin of St. Stephen's and St. Agnes School, and Tarik Sesay and Victoria Patrick of Alexandria City High School! We can't wait to see what your futures hold! 🎉

🏀 In addition to celebrating our Athletes of the Month, we had a round-table featuring EIGHT local basketball coaches from all four schools! They went in to depth on multiple topics, including how to teach different types of players, the importance of having fun during practice, and even the true nature of Steph Curry's influence on basketball. Thank you to Coaches Bryant and Walton of Bishop Ireton High School, Coaches Sally and Gonzalez of Alexandria City High School, Coaches Reed and Fitzpatrick of Episcopal High School, and Coaches Crenshaw and Hunter of St. Stephen's and St. Agnes School for a great discussion!

Last week, the Alexandria Sportsman's Club hosted a High School Football Coaches Roundtable featuring head coaches Rodney Hughey, Alexandria City HS; Bernard Joseph, Bishop Ireton HS; Kadeem Rodgers, Episcopal HS; and Vashon Winton, SSSAS. ASC president, Ryan Fannon, emceed the event. Coaches discussed the current season in Alexandria as well as insights into coaching local students.
